A prankster is someone who plays pranks — a person who sets up tricks to make other people look silly. The word can sound almost fond, like a class clown who loves a joke, or it can sound less kind, like someone who never knows when to stop. News stories and online videos often call a repeat joker a prankster. It is informal to neutral, a little cheerful and story-like in tone, but still in use. You would not put it in a very serious report unless you wanted that flavour.
